Lingling Wang is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Lingling Wang has authored 818 papers receiving a total of 26.5k indexed citations (citations by other indexed papers that have themselves been cited), including 330 papers in Materials Chemistry, 300 papers in Electrical and Electronic Engineering and 245 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Lingling Wang's work include Plasmonic and Surface Plasmon Research (183 papers), Metamaterials and Metasurfaces Applications (123 papers) and Advanced Photocatalysis Techniques (91 papers). Lingling Wang is often cited by papers focused on Plasmonic and Surface Plasmon Research (183 papers), Metamaterials and Metasurfaces Applications (123 papers) and Advanced Photocatalysis Techniques (91 papers). Lingling Wang collaborates with scholars based in China, United States and Australia. Lingling Wang's co-authors include Xiang Zhai, Shengxuan Xia, Wei‐Qing Huang, Qi Lin, Liang Xu, Hongju Li, Wei Yu, Ben-Xin Wang, Taihong Wang and Qiuhong Li and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and Nature Communications.
